Transparent

Transparent refers to a quality or characteristic of an object or substance that allows light to pass through it without significant scattering, enabling objects behind it to be clearly seen. In a broader context, transparency can also denote clarity and openness in processes, practices, or communications, ensuring that information is accessible and understandable. In this sense, transparency is often associated with honesty, accountability, and integrity, particularly in governance, organizations, and social interactions.
